Abstract
The utility model discloses an electronic components technical field's an electronic components with heat dissipation dust cover, which comprises an outer shell, the outer wall of shell is evenly opened there is the aperture, shell cavity bottom central point puts the fixedly connected with back shaft, electronic component is installed in the left side of back shaft, the outer wall of back shaft has cup jointed the bearing, and the outer wall fixed connection of the inner circle of bearing and back shaft, the dustproof heat dissipation case of right side fixedly connected with of bearing, this electronic components with heat dissipation dust cover, the shell plays protection electronic components and dustproof heat abstractor, the aperture sets up a week at the shell, make the dust and the heat of shell cavity's all angles all can the effluvium, back shaft played a supporting role, it the carrier of each spare part work, the bearing cup joints on the outer wall of back shaft, the right -hand member fixed connection's of bearing dustproof heat dissipation case can rotate around the back shaft through the bearing.

Refer to Fig. 1-2, this utility model provides a kind of technical scheme:A kind of electronics unit device with radiating dustproof shell
Part, including shell 1, the outer wall of described shell 1 uniformly has aperture 2, and described shell 1 intracavity bottom center is fixedly connected with
Support shaft 3, the left side of described support shaft 3 is provided with electronic component 4, and the outer wall of described support shaft 3 is socketed with bearing 5, and bearing 5
Inner ring be fixedly connected with the outer wall of support shaft 3, the right side of described bearing 5 is fixedly connected with dust-proof radiating case 6, described dust-proof dissipates
The top of hot tank 6 is connected with rotating shaft 7, and the top of described rotating shaft 7 is fixedly connected with active spur gear 8, described active spur gear 8
Left side is engaged with driven spur gear 9, and on the fixedly sleeved outer wall in support shaft 3 of driven spur gear 9, described driven spur gear 9
It is provided with positioning sleeve 10 and bearing 5 between, the left end of described positioning sleeve 10 is actively socketed on the outer wall of support shaft 3, and position
The right-hand member of set 10 is actively socketed on the outer wall of rotating shaft 7, and the inner chamber of described dust-proof radiating case 6 is connected with motor by support
11, the right-hand member of described motor 11 output shaft is socketed with flabellum 12, and the left end of described motor 11 output shaft is socketed with initiative taper
Gear 13, the left side of described drive bevel gear 13 is engaged with driven wheel of differential 14, and the top of driven wheel of differential 14 and rotating shaft 7
Bottom is fixedly connected.
Wherein, the top of described support shaft 3 is provided with base, and screw and shell 1 are passed through in the left and right two ends of base top
Bottom connect so that the structure of support shaft 3 is more stable, the right side wall of described dust-proof radiating case 6 has an air holes, and air holes
Position and aperture 2, in same level, in same level, are easy to distributing of dust and heat, described flabellum 12 passes through spiral shell
Nail is connected with the output shaft of motor 11, is completely embedded, structure is firm.
Operation principle:Aperture 2 be arranged on one week of shell 1 so that the dust of all angles of shell 1 inner chamber and heat all
Shed, support shaft 3 is played a supporting role, bearing 5 is socketed on the outer wall of support shaft 3, the right-hand member of bearing 5 is fixedly connected
Dust-proof radiating case 6 can be rotated around support shaft 3 by bearing 5, and motor 11 rotates, flabellum with 12 motor 11 power defeated
Shaft rotates, the other end of the output shaft of motor 11 passes through drive bevel gear 13 and driven wheel of differential 14 change powerdriven
Direction, and reduce rotating speed, power passes through rotating shaft 7 from active spur gear 8 to driven spur gear 9, and driven spur gear 9 is fixedly sleeved
On the outer wall of support shaft 3, when active spur gear 8 rotates, driven spur gear 9 stands, thus active spur gear 8 can drive anti-
Dirt heat dissipation tank 6 moves in a circle around support shaft 3, completes the dedusting of inner chamber and radiating to shell 1 simultaneously.
